Garbage hopper blockage alarm device
Technical Field
The application relates to the technical field of waste incineration, in particular to a blocking alarm device for a waste hopper.
Background
With the increase of the support of renewable energy sources and comprehensive utilization policies in China, people pay more and more attention to the industry of utilizing the garbage incinerator for garbage incineration power generation as a new resource comprehensive utilization industry, and the garbage feeding device is a premise of garbage incineration, so that the normal operation of the garbage feeding device is required to be ensured.
Due to the complexity of the waste components, hopper blockage can occur during operation of a waste incineration power plant. If the situation that the material layer in the furnace is broken if not found in time, the situation that the furnace temperature is reduced and even flameout occurs, and the safety production and the environment-friendly operation are seriously affected.
In view of the above-mentioned related art, the inventors believe that failure to find out that the hopper is clogged in time has a serious influence on safe production, incineration operation, and the like.

Detailed Description
The present application is described in further detail below with reference to figures 1-2.
The embodiment of the application discloses rubbish hopper blocks up alarm device.
Referring to fig. 1, the garbage hopper blockage alarm device comprises a hopper 1, a material level monitoring system 2 and an alarm system 3.
Hopper 1 is used for leading rubbish to the incinerator, and material level monitoring system 2 is used for monitoring the position change of rubbish in hopper 1 to video signal transmission for alarm system 3 will monitor, and alarm system 3 carries out the analysis to the video signal in the certain period, according to the rubbish position change condition in the video signal, judges whether jam appears, and then judges whether need report to the police. The position change of the garbage in the hopper 1 can be monitored in real time, if the garbage is blocked, the garbage can be timely alarmed, a worker is reminded to process the garbage, and the situations of flameout and the like caused by burning and material cutting are avoided as much as possible.
Referring to fig. 1 and 2, in order to make the position change of the garbage in the hopper 1 easier to be recognized, 3 scales 11 are arranged in the hopper 1 along the circumferential direction of the inner wall, a groove is arranged at the scale mark of each scale 11, a light emitting tube 12 is arranged in each groove, and the light emitting tube 12 can be a light emitting diode. The light-emitting tube 12 emits light to illuminate the scale 11, so that the position change of the garbage relative to the scale 11 is easier to be recognized.
In order to enable the position of the refuse in the hopper 1 to be identified, the level monitoring system 2 comprises a camera 21 and a video distributor 22. The upper edge of the hopper 1 is provided with a camera shooting groove 13, and the camera 21 is positioned in the camera shooting groove 13. The video camera 21 monitors the refuse in the hopper 1 in real time and the video distributor 22 transmits the video signals captured by the video camera 21 to the alarm system 3. The video distributor 22 may be a JC-0104V-1 in 4 out type video distributor 22.
The alarm system 3 includes a computer 31 and an alarm 32. The computer 31 analyzes the video signal transmitted by the video distributor 22 in a certain period, and judges whether the position of the garbage in the hopper 1 changes relative to the scale 11, if so, the garbage in the hopper 1 normally descends and is not blocked, and the alarm 32 does not give an alarm; if the relative scale 11 of rubbish in the hopper 1 does not change, then hopper 1 blocks up, and alarm 32 reports to the police, reminds operating personnel to handle in time, avoids burning the circumstances such as disconnected material, flame-out as far as possible. The alarm 32 may be an audible and visual alarm.
In order to enable the camera 21 to stably shoot continuously, the alarm device further comprises a monitoring protection component 4, the monitoring protection component 4 comprises a protection cover 41 for sealing the camera shooting groove 13, and the protection cover 41 is arranged in a transparent mode and can be made of high-temperature-resistant organic glass. One side that the safety cover 41 is located hopper 1 medial surface is equipped with clearance brush 42, and clearance brush 42 rotates through axle and bearing and safety cover 41 in the middle part to be connected, and clearance groove 421 has been seted up to clearance brush 42 one end. The upper surface of the protective cover 41 is provided with a plate, a reciprocating driving element 43 is fixed on the plate through a bolt, a cleaning disc 431 is fixed at the end part of the reciprocating driving element 43 through a bolt, a cleaning lug 432 is fixed on the cleaning disc 431, and the cleaning lug 432 is positioned in the cleaning groove 421. The reciprocating drive 43 may be a motor.
The reciprocating driving member 43 drives the cleaning disc 431 to rotate, the cleaning disc 431 drives the cleaning lug 432 to move, the cleaning lug slides in the cleaning groove 421 to drive the cleaning brush 42 to do reciprocating swing, and the cleaning protective cover 41 is positioned on the side surface of one side of the inner side wall of the hopper 1. The side face of the protective cover 41 on one side of the inner side wall is prevented from being stuck with garbage as far as possible, and the influence on the camera shooting is avoided.
In order to prevent the camera 21 from being affected by overheating caused by long-term sealing in the camera shooting groove 13, the fan 44 is arranged on the side surface of the protective cover 41 positioned on the outer side wall side of the hopper 1, and the fan 44 ventilates the camera shooting groove 13, so that the camera 21 has a good working environment, and the using effect of the camera 21 is improved.
The implementation principle that the alarm 32 is blocked by the garbage hopper 1 in the embodiment of the application is as follows:
in the first step, the camera 21 continuously shoots the position of the garbage in the hopper 1, and the video distributor 22 processes the video signal shot by the camera 21 in a certain period of time and transmits the processed video signal to the computer 31.
Secondly, the computer 31 analyzes whether the garbage in the hopper 1 is descending or not according to the video signal transmitted by the video distributor 22, if the garbage in the hopper 1 is descending, the garbage in the hopper 1 is not blocked, the alarm 32 does not give an alarm, and if the garbage in the hopper 1 is not descending, the garbage in the hopper 1 is blocked, and then the alarm 32 gives an alarm.
The blockage of the hopper 1 can be found in time, and an operator can find the blockage of the hopper 1 and can process the blockage in time, so that the conditions of material cutting, flameout and the like during burning are avoided as much as possible.
Thirdly, the reciprocating driving member 43 drives the cleaning disc 431 to rotate, the cleaning disc 431 drives the cleaning lug 432 to move, the cleaning lug slides in the cleaning groove 421 to drive the cleaning brush 42 to do reciprocating swing, and the cleaning protective cover 41 is positioned on the side surface of one side of the inner side wall of the hopper 1. The side face of the protective cover 41 on one side of the inner side wall is prevented from being stuck with garbage as far as possible, and the influence on the camera shooting is avoided. Meanwhile, the fan 44 ventilates the camera slot 13, so that the camera 21 has a good working environment, and the using effect of the camera 21 is improved.
